Помогите с нахождением альфы в SKSpriteNode

spritekit

#1

Делаю игру на SpriteKit, и пытаюсь сделать так чтобы SKSpriteNode реагировал на прикосновение только если прикосновение было на часть текстуры с изображением.
может ли кто помочь с решением этой задачи???


#2
  private func touchLocationModel(recognizer: UIGestureRecognizer, completion: @escaping(String, SCNNode) -> Void) {
    let touchLocation = recognizer.location(in: sceneView!)
    let hitTestResult = sceneView!.hitTest(touchLocation)
    
    if let result = hitTestResult.first {
        if let name =  result.name {
           print(name) // name node
       }
    }
   }

#3

Наверно я не докончат полно описал задачу. Суть не реагировать на альфу.